OpenAI Expands Its Ecosystem with ChatGPT Atlas Browser
In a strategic move to deepen its integration into users’ daily digital lives, OpenAI has officially launched the ChatGPT Atlas web browser. This marks a significant expansion beyond the company’s established AI chatbot, positioning OpenAI as a more direct competitor in the browser market. The initial release is available for macOS, with versions for Windows, iOS, and Android platforms slated to follow soon, signaling a comprehensive cross-platform approach.

More Than a Browser: The AI-Centric Philosophy
Atlas is not merely a new shell for viewing web pages; it is conceived as an intelligent assistant for the web. OpenAI has leveraged its extensive expertise in artificial intelligence to embed a suite of AI-driven features directly into the browsing experience. One of the standout features is its ability to learn from a user’s browsing history. By analyzing patterns and interests, Atlas can proactively suggest relevant content, articles, or resources, effectively transforming the browser from a passive tool into an active research partner. This could fundamentally change how users interact with the vast information available online, making serendipitous discovery a core part of the experience.
Strategic Implications and Market Disruption
The launch of ChatGPT Atlas represents a bold challenge to established players like Google Chrome, Mozilla Firefox, and Apple’s Safari. While these browsers have incorporated AI elements, OpenAI is betting that a browser built from the ground up with AI at its core will offer a superior and more integrated experience. This move aligns with the industry‘s broader shift towards more contextual and personalized computing.
OpenAI CEO Sam Altman has hinted that the current version is merely the foundation. His comments about adding “way more stuff that we will tell you about later” and the potential to take the project “pretty far” suggest a long-term roadmap.
